AbstractFurther studies on differing susceptibilities of Pinus nigra clones to Scleroderris lagerbergii.In a seed orchard 14 clones of Austrian black pine(Pinus nigrassp.nigra)showed significant differences of susceptibility toScleroderris lagerbergii.
